Lines Matching defs:currentStart
1634 uint32_t currentStart = startingBlock;
1664 retval = BlockFindContiguous(vcb, currentStart, vcb->allocLimit, minBlocks,
1667 if (retval == dskFulErr && currentStart != 0) {
1679 retval = BlockFindContiguous(vcb, 1, currentStart, minBlocks,
1732 * advance currentStart to the point just past the overlap we just found. Note that
1735 currentStart = nextStart;
4851 u_int32_t currentStart, currentEnd, endBlock;
4866 currentStart = hfsmp->vcbFreeExt[i].startBlock;
4867 currentEnd = currentStart + hfsmp->vcbFreeExt[i].blockCount;
4873 if (currentEnd <= startBlock || currentStart >= endBlock) {
4881 if (startBlock <= currentStart && endBlock >= currentEnd) {
4903 if (startBlock > currentStart && endBlock < currentEnd) {
4905 add_free_extent_list(hfsmp, currentStart, startBlock - currentStart);
4924 if (startBlock > currentStart) {
4926 insertedIndex = add_free_extent_list(hfsmp, currentStart, startBlock - currentStart);